Product Description:

The EL2819 EtherCAT Terminal offers 16 sourcing digital outputs. It is made by Beckhoff for industrial automation. Each channel functions with a PNP-type configuration. The terminal functions at a rated voltage of 24 V DC. It takes input voltage between 20.4 V and 28.8 V DC. Each channel offers a max output current of 0.5 A.

The cumulative current of EL2819 EtherCAT Terminal for all the channels is limited to 4 A. Short-circuit protection on each output is provided. The short-circuit current does not exceed 1 A per channel. Switching operations are available at up to 1 kHz for resistive loads. Turn-on time is the same or shorter than 100 µs. Turn-off time is no more than 500 µs. Protection against reverse polarity is offered in the supply input. E-bus power supply is generally 90 mA. The EL2819 EtherCAT Terminal is resistive, lamp-type, and inductive load supported. The output data has 2 bytes in the process image. Diagnostics include the detection of short circuits and overloads. It also provides open load recognition and an overtemperature alert. Individual status LEDs are provided for each output. Green signifies an active output signal. Red indicates overload or error. Flashing red indicates a short to the 24 V supply. Alternating red and green signals indicate an open load.

Spring-clamp EL2819 EtherCAT Terminal facilitates quick one-wire connections per channel. Solid wires 0.08 mm² to 1.5 mm² are accepted. Stranded wires 0.25 mm² to 1.5 mm² are accepted. Wires with ferrules can be 0.14 mm² to 0.75 mm². The terminal can work between 0 °C and +55 °C. The temperature range during storage is -25 °C to +85 °C. The terminal protection class rating is IP20. Field and EtherCAT sides feature 500 V electrical isolation. Process data is handled in a 16-bit format.

Frequently Asked Questions about EL2819:

Q: Why is the 0.5 A per-channel current rating crucial in EL2819 EtherCAT Terminal?

A: It provides a balance between performance and safety, allowing sufficient output current without exceeding thermal limits. The EL2819 uses this limit to ensure long-term reliability.

Q: How do the individual status LEDs aid diagnostics in EL2819 EtherCAT Terminal?

A: LEDs offer real-time visual feedback for each output, indicating operational state or error. This feature streamlines troubleshooting and maintenance tasks for EL2819.

Q: How does open load recognition improve system reliability in EL2819?

A: It detects disconnected or faulty loads, preventing unnoticed failures in the automation system. This proactive alerting ensures continuous system operation in the EL2819.

Q: What is the role of 2-byte output data in EL2819?

A: The 2-byte data format allows for efficient data mapping in the process image. It supports better integration with control systems for EL2819 EtherCAT Terminal.

Q: How does the 1 kHz switching capability of EL2819 enhance performance?

A: This high switching frequency allows for faster and more precise control of resistive loads. It's ideal for time-sensitive automation tasks in the EL2819 EtherCAT Terminal.
